Stay Alert to Avoid the Costs of Distracted Driving

Stay Alert to Avoid the Costs of Distracted Driving

Imagine driving down the highway at 55 mph. You glance at your phone for just five seconds to check a text—those five seconds have just seen you cross the length of a football field completely blindfolded. This alarming thought underscores a pressing issue: distracted driving, one of the leading causes of accidents nationwide.

The Dangers of Distraction

Distracted driving is responsible for countless accidents each year. Even a seemingly harmless phone call can be perilous, reducing the brain activity associated with driving by 37%. The consequences are not just physical but financial as well, contributing to rising insurance premiums. A single ticket for phone use behind the wheel can boost your insurance costs significantly.

Actionable Steps to Stay Focused

Fortunately, there are simple changes you can make to enhance your focus on the road. Consider enabling the “Do Not Disturb” feature on your phone while driving or storing it in the glove compartment to avoid temptation. Maintain awareness of other distractions such as loud music or chatty passengers, and use safe-driving apps that reward attentive behavior. These small adjustments can help prevent accidents and save money in the long run.
